Research Interests

  • Technologies for mitigating carbon dioxide emissions, particularly from heavy industries (e.g. Iron and Steel, Cement, Chemicals etc.)
  • Carbon dioxide capture and storage (CCS) and air capture (capture of carbon dioxide from ambient air)
  • UK and international climate change mitigation policy
  • Energy efficiency: technologies, policies and barriers to uptake
  • Incentivising behavioural change in order to reduce individual and corporate carbon footprints
